Depends. Crane is the east side k-3. If you stay east side it’s also Winslow k-3, Sherman 4-6, Roth 7-9, and the combined senior high school 10-12. On the west side of henrietta it’s Fyle and Leary k-3, Vollmer 4-6, Burger 7-9, and then the high school.

Diaper booster pads are a thing and work great. They are just a rectangular pad you add to the diaper to increase its absorption volume. Now in premie size these would likely be too big. They do come in different sizes and thicknesses. We have bought them on Amazon and at the local baby store. Amazon has a better selection.

Costco is cheapest. The bad reviews of the service center are not due to tires or installation, they are due to slow service and long wait times. If you understand that if you aren’t the first appointment (9:15 am via call to tire center for executive members or 10 am for regular gold star members) you sr likely to wait longer than other places. My wait times with the first or second appointment have been anywhere from 1 to 3.5 hours for both rotations and installs. The free flat tire repair/road hazard is more of a potential perk. Depending on when it happens to you it may be a day or 4 before you can get in.

But their prices can’t me beat. I hate it but keep going back for the $150-700 savings per set of tires.

I have a saltwater above ground in western NY. 12x24 oval. Chlorine generation has been great the last 3 years. It really has cut down on my maintenance time and has offered a consistently crystal clear pool.especially since we are away for a few weeks every summer. Never come home to a cloudy or green pool. I would recommend buying a larger generator than required as that allows you to easily “shock” the pool by turning up the generator. Most warranties on swg parts are prorated.

I did have to buy a new controller and salt cell after the 3rd year which made me angry. The claim was that water had gotten into the controller and had migrated on wiring. The warrant knocked about 40% off. That being said it has been a loser in pure money numbers considering my initial cost and replacement cost. However when i factor in the ease of maintenance and lack of having to maintain a stock of liquid or puck chlorine i feel ahead.

The enclosed tub room sounds like a great idea but the reality of it is more upfront expense, more maintenance, extra systems for air exchange. And the points about demolition to replace the tub are a real long term concern. If you do enclose make sure it uses durable materials like tile for flooring and has a robust air exchange/ventilation system to manage the moisture. And I would bake into the design a plan for replacing the tub down the road without having to do destructive demolition.

We built a ground level small deck off the back of the garage so we can just step outside to the tub. It backs up to a raised portion of our backyard deck behind the house so that makes it private on that side. We added moveable outdoor curtains or emt conduit curtain rods on each end of the hot tub deck to enclose it for privacy and wind block. And for rain or intense sun we added a retractable awning to the house that extends out over the deck and tub. We also added an outdoor shower and changing area.

With the awning we can be out there in the rain or light snow and not be bothered. And since it’s right off the house we have a wall mounted tv and dimmable lighting.

And since the deck is directly accessible from the side yard when the time comes to replace the tub it can be forklifted off the deck and replaced easily.

And if it turns out that we don’t use or want to replace the tub down the road we can remove it and have a deck to use as we see fit, or demo it and set it back to yard easily.
